SHPEP’s founding partner and core funder, the Robert Wood Johnson Foundation (RWJF), is shifting their strategic priorities, and will end their funding of our work at the conclusion of our 2026 summer cohort. The decision is not a reflection on our program’s performance, and RWJF remains committed to making health systems more diverse, equitable, and inclusive. The American Association of Medical Colleges (AAMC), the American Dental Education Association (ADEA), and RWJF proudly recognize the vast impact SHPEP has made over the past 37 years in supporting tens of thousands of future health professionals. The AAMC and ADEA are exploring the future of this program and how we may continue our mission in new ways. We will share updates in the coming year. HOSA’s International Leadership Conference is the highlight of the year for every HOSA member and advisors and includes:

  • Competitive events focused on leadership, professional and technical skills
  • The annual business of the international student organization of HOSA by the voting delegates
  • Educational Seminars, Workshops & Exhibits presented by professional partners that provide Information about current health care issues
  • An opportunity to meet people from across the globe with similar career goals
  • Exciting general sessions providing recognition and opportunity for all HOSA members!
